This page introduces PlaceholderHealth as a public staff guide. It focuses on what the tool does, how authorized staff get started, and which commands are useful.

Read-only server health monitor for configured server and 1MB placeholders with ok/warn/error checks and Markdown exports.

Start with /placeholderhealth. The sections below explain what PlaceholderHealth is for, which commands authorized staff can use, and what its output means.

Available features include:

  • Parse configured PlaceholderAPI samples only.
  • Support server-level samples and online-player-required samples.
  • Flag unresolved placeholders, %…% output, errors, empty values, and slow parse times.
  • Show ok/warn/error rows in console or in game for permitted admins.
  • Export the latest or freshly-run check as a Discord-friendly Markdown report.
  • Stay passive: it never edits PlaceholderAPI, CMI, holograms, configs, or playerdata.

CommandWhat it doesExample
/placeholderhealthOpens or shows the main PlaceholderHealth player view./placeholderhealth
/placeholderhealth infoShows a friendly explanation of what PlaceholderHealth does./placeholderhealth info
/placeholderhealth helpShows the PlaceholderHealth commands available to you./placeholderhealth help
/placeholderhealth check [player]Runs the PlaceholderHealth check action./placeholderhealth check
/placeholderhealth list [page]Lists available PlaceholderHealth entries./placeholderhealth list
